The clinical nurse is a professional Registered Nurse who assumes responsibility and accountability for a group of patients for a designated time frame and provides care to these patients using the nursing process in accordance with the standards of professional nursing practice. The clinical nurse performs in the professional role as described by the American Nurses Association (ANA); engaging in activities related to ethics, education, evidence-based practice and research, quality improvement, leadership, collaboration, professional practice evaluation, resources utilization, environmental health, and patient advocacy as appropriate to clinical nursing practice.
The staff RN is a professional caregiver who provides pre-operative evaluation and medical screening of patients having anesthesia for a surgery or procedure, by reviewing and evaluating internal and external medical and other relevant documents and conducting a pre-operative phone interview (or on-site clinical review) of the patient.
The RN will apply critical thinking processes for identification and scoring of identified and potential risk factors of surgical patients and collaborate with the surgical team for pre-operative assessment, recommendations and management. Throughout the evaluative process, the RN will teach and instruct patients on pre-operative care management and coordinate care with the physician, patient and staff.
The RN is responsible for maintaining efficient patient flow, clinical assessment, planning, initiating medical interventions and diagnostic workups, and communicating with patient/family/physician regarding any medical issues that may hinder or prevent surgery/treatment plans. The RN will utilize problem solving, systems planning and patient care management skills at PEPC Westwood clinic and completing pre-anesthesia evaluation of procedural patients as needed. The RN will also facilitate and maintain the workflow of the clinic, obtain and complete clinical documentation and care of preoperative patients.
